Crash on the A407 - 16 Jan 1989
Accident reference 198901QK00032
Accident summary
On Monday 16 January 1989 at 08:25 a slight collision occurred near A407 involving 1 vehicle (bus or coach (17 or more pass seats)) and 1 casualty (1 slight) Weather at the time was recorded as fine no high winds. Road surface conditions were dry. Lighting was described as daylight.
Key details
- Posted speed limit: 30 mph
- Road type: Dual carriageway
- Junction: T or staggered junction
